Reflection in c# is a mechanism that allows a program to inspect metadata and interact with types at runtime. it enables developers to discover information about assemblies, modules, types, methods, properties and other members dynamically. Reflection is a versatile tool for dynamic programming in c#, enabling scenarios like plugin architectures, serialization, and di. however, it should be used judiciously due to performance and maintainability costs.
